Okay so I just went to AT&T and they replaced my SIM card in attempt to fix my wonky Searching---5 Bars volley and now I'm wondering the following
1) What is stored on the Sim card for iPhones. I know contacts are stored on the Sim card but I don't think the iPhone's contacts get on there
2) Is there anything else that needs to be reconfigured other then my voicemail (all that needed to be updated was the visual part, just had to wait for it to ask for my password again)

Just wanting to make sure on these in case something comes up

GuitarRocker
05-06-2009, 11:46 PM
The SIM card only stores network settings, nothing should be different at all. Some, mostly older phones, store Contacts on the SIM card, but the iPhone doesn't.
